ASUU Declares Two-Week Warning Strike, Begins Monday Nationwide
The Academic Staff Union of Universities (ASUU) has announced a two-week nationwide warning strike, set to begin Monday, October 13, 2025. This order, directed at all branches of the union in Nigeria’s public universities, was delivered by ASUU National President, Prof. Chris Piwuna, during a press briefing in Abuja. Super Eagles in Mid-Air Scare as Plane Makes Emergency Landing in Angola
Nigeria’s senior men’s national football team, the Super Eagles, had a narrow escape on Saturday after the aircraft conveying them from South Africa made an emergency landing in Luanda, Angola, due to a technical fault.
